drat. The Skyward Sword any% record was on 4h50. Then, by applying a glitch called "reverse bitmagic"*, gymnast86 did a very casual run earlier this week bringing it down to 4h17.

And he did another run yesterday, putting it on 3h53. It'll probably go down further after a few months of optimizing this run.

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=0CLhuBrtEiw

* BiT = back in time, meaning you can get control of Link while on the title screen. This could already be used in a couple ways such as "BiT warps" where your location in Title Screen Skyloft would be transferred to certain places in other maps. Reverse bitmagic is a way to set flags in BiT Skyloft that then get transferred to other maps. This includes stuff like unlocked doors.
